• Intended initially for applications to larger buses and lorries, the prototype of a gas turbine developing 300 bhp has been produced by the Nissan Motor Co Ltd, Nissan Building, Ginza, Chuo-ku, Tokyo, Japan, as the outcome of seven years of research. It is of the closed-cycle type with variable nozzles and is claimed to reduce atmosphere pollution because of its "near-perfect" efficiency.

Speeds of the compressor and power turbine are 40,000 rpm and 30,000 rpm respectively. The heat exchanger is of the rotary-disc type and electronic controls are employed.
